Volunteers

Volunteers are the keys to a great event.

You will find volunteers at registration, over a hot stove, dishing up food in a serving line, making sure aid stations are ready and waiting for runners, operating HAM radios for communication, running shuttles, setting up the course, tearing down the course and waving goodbye to runners as they depart and volunteers begin cleanup. Volunteers are responsible for their own transportation and lodging.

For some events, such as Big Bend Ultra, we need volunteer mountain bikers to help with trail setup, tear down and safety patrol. If you are good with a full day of trails (not terribly tough, but requires fitness and experience) it’s a fantastic place to ride. You must be able to take care of your own flats etc. and other gear.

It sounds tough (and it can be), but volunteers love the work. No matter what your talent or capabilities, if you want to volunteer, we can find a job for you. It’s a lot of fun, and runners who aren’t ready for an Ultra can get some first hand experience in this event.

Volunteer Benefits

All volunteers will have their park entry fees coverage, meals covered while volunteering, and a race tee-shirt or Trail Roots swag (while supplies last).

Race Credit

Volunteers who complete the requirements for their role will be provided race credit!

3-5 hr of volunteer work = $35 race credit

6-8 hours of volunteer work = $60 race credit

9-12 hours of volunteer work = $100 race credit

12+ hours of volunteer work = $130 race credit

*race credits must be used within 1 year of your volunteer date. Volunteers need to submit their hours post race to volunteer coordinator to receive credit and discounts. Volunteers must follow the Trail Roots code of conduct and be on time and fulfill their specified role to receive full credit.
